放れる
This verb follows the ichidan conjugation pattern. This verb can also mean the following: get free
Latinized
Translation
Hiragana
私/俺
Present informal tense
放れる
hanareru
I leave
Present informal negative tense
放れない
hanarenai
I don't leave
Present formal tense
放れます
hanaremasu
I leave
Present formal negative tense
放れません
hanaremasen
I do not leave
私/俺
Past informal tense
放れた
hanareta
I left
Past informal negative tense
放れなかった
hanarenakatta
I didn't leave
Past formal tense
放れました
hanaremashita
I leave
Past formal negative tense
放れませんでした
hanaremasen deshita
I did not leave
私/俺
Imperative informal mood
放れよ
hanareyo
leave
Imperative negative mood
放れるな
hanareru na
don't leave
Imperative formal mood
放れてください
hanarete kudasai
please leave
Imperative formal negative mood
放れないでください
hanarenai dekudasai
please do not leave
私/俺
Te form - conjunctive stem
放れて
hanarete
leave
Passive stem
放れられる
hanarerareru
left
Hypothetical tense
放れれ
hanarere
if I left
Hypothetical conditional stem
放れれば
hanarereba
left
私/俺
Volitional stem
放れよう
hanareyō
will leave
Potential stem
放れられる
hanarerareru
left
Continuative stem
放れ
hanare
leaving
Causative stem
放れさせる
hanaresaseru
allow to leave
私/俺
Imperfective stem
放れ
hanare
leave
